潜在的神经认知机制是数量歧视的基础,在有或没有数学学习障碍的儿童中

概括
患有数学学习障碍 (MLD) 的儿童难以适应数字符号的策略,这影响了更广泛的数学技能. 这与关键区域的大脑活动减少有关,这表明MLD涉及元认知和象征性处理缺陷.

背景情况:
- 数学学习障碍 (MLD) 影响许多儿童,但其神经认知基础尚未完全理解.
- 现有的研究往往侧重于基本的数字处理,可能会忽视其他有助于的因素.
研究的目的:
- 通过创新的计算模型和功能性脑成像来研究MLD背后的神经认知机制.
- 检查与典型发育儿童相比,MLD儿童如何处理象征性和非象征性数字信息.
主要方法:
- 开发带有动态性能监测 (DDM-DPM) 的漂移扩散模型,以分析任务性能变化.
- 将DDM-DPM与功能性脑成像 (fMRI) 结合起来,在量差异化任务中评估大脑活动.
- 在象征性和非象征性任务上,MLD儿童和典型发育的儿童的比较.
主要成果:
- 患有MLD的儿童表现出改变的反应谨慎和后错误调整,特别是在象征性任务中,尽管整体表现相似.
- 在象征性歧视中潜伏的认知过程比非象征性过程更强烈地预测了数学能力.
- 中额前和前带皮层活动的减少与MLD儿童的特定缺陷相关.
结论:
- 多维数字处理涉及多维缺陷,包括元认知和监管过程,而不仅仅是基本的数字处理.
- 这些发现支持并扩展了访问赤字模型,突出了与符号数字表示的斗争.
- 整合认知建模和神经成像对于理解学习障碍和开发有针对性的干预措施至关重要.

Learning Disabilities
632
Learning disabilities are cognitive disorders caused by neurological impairments that affect cognitive functions like language and reading, without indicating overall intellectual or developmental challenges. These disabilities differ from global intellectual or developmental disabilities as they are limited to distinct cognitive functions. Common learning disabilities include dysgraphia, dyslexia, and dyscalculia, each of which impacts unique aspects of learning.

Base Quantities and Derived Quantities
26.5K
In any system of units, the units for some physical quantities must be specified through a measurement process. These measurements are the base quantities of the system, and their units are the base units of the system. The algebraic combinations of the base values can then be used to express all other physical quantities. Each of these physical quantities is then referred to as a derived quantity, with each unit being referred to as a derived unit.

Intellectual Disability
773
Intellectual disability (ID) is a neurodevelopmental condition characterized by deficits in intellectual and adaptive functioning that manifest during the developmental period. This condition encompasses challenges in reasoning, memory, problem-solving, and learning, accompanied by impairments in everyday life skills, such as communication, self-care, and social interactions.
